How Does Water Temperature Affect Coffee Balance?
Water temperature directly impacts coffee balance by influencing water chemistry and extraction consistency. When you maintain temperature stability, you guarantee even extraction of flavors, preventing under- or over-extraction. Too hot, and the water might extract bitter compounds; too cold, and it can miss out on delicate aromatics. Keeping the right temperature helps you achieve a harmonious flavor profile, making your coffee taste just right and truly balanced.
What Role Does Grind Size Play in Flavor Balance?
Grind size plays a vital role in flavor balance by controlling extraction. When you maintain grind consistency and choose the right particle size, you guarantee even extraction, which prevents over- or under-extraction. Fine grinds extract more quickly, highlighting bright flavors, while coarse grinds slow down extraction, emphasizing body and richness. Adjusting particle size helps you fine-tune the flavor profile, making certain your coffee feels balanced and complete.
Can Storage Methods Impact Coffee’s Taste Harmony?
Yes, storage methods considerably impact coffee’s taste harmony. Using airtight storage containers helps preserve flavor by preventing exposure to air, moisture, and light that degrade beans over time. Proper storage maintains freshness and aroma, ensuring each brew retains its intended balance. Avoiding clear or flimsy containers keeps out harmful elements, allowing your coffee to stay flavorful and consistent, ultimately making your cup feel complete and well-rounded.
How Does Brewing Time Influence the Coffee’s Completeness?
Brewing time directly influences the coffee’s completeness by affecting flavor extraction and aroma preservation. If you brew too short, you may miss out on essential flavors, resulting in a weak taste. Conversely, over-brewing can lead to bitterness and lost aroma. Finding the right brewing time guarantees ideal flavor extraction, preserving the coffee’s rich aroma and creating a balanced, satisfying cup that feels complete and harmonious.
